Safety and Efficacy of Pulmonary Vein Isolation Using Pulsed-field Ablation (PFA) Combined with Either PFA-based Left Atrial Posterior Wall Isolation or Vein of Marshall Ethanol Ablation in Patients with Persistent Atrial Fibrillation
Lead Sponsor:
Texas Cardiac Arrhythmia Research Foundation
Conditions:
Atrial Fibrillation (AF)
Eligibility:
All Genders
18-85 years
Brief Summary
This study is designed to directly compare the safety and efficacy of PFA-based PVI+PWI vs PFA-based PVI+ VoM alcohol ablation in patients with Persistent AF.
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Symptomatic persistent AF; 1st or redo ablation with PVI-only in the earlier procedure
- Willing to provide informed consent
- Age: 18-85 years
Exclusion
- • Previous PWI or VoM ablation procedure
- Left ventricular ejection fraction \<40%
- Left atrial thrombus
- Myocardial infarction within last 60 days
- Cardiac surgery in the last 6 months
- Advanced renal failure
- Life expectancy \<1 year
- Pregnant women
- Unable or unwilling to provide informed consent
